Unveiling the Epic Saga of the Vanished Princess

In Active DBG: Brave’s Rage, a timeless legend unfolds where brave Braves have fought the powerful Ancient Dragon forever to save their beloved Princess. This heroic cycle decides the kingdom’s fate, but a strange turn of events changes everything: the Dragon and Princess both disappear without a trace. Players put together pairs of heroes to go on random quests that reveal secrets through procedurally generated maps full of events and treasures.

As the journey goes on through 20 levels of increasing difficulty, more and more lore is revealed. Unlock alter egos for your Braves, such as the armored Knight Kiki or the mysterious Explorer Evra. These characters have hidden backstories that are connected to the kingdom’s problems. Each run builds toward facing the mysterious forces behind the disappearance, combining classic fantasy elements with roguelike unpredictability to create a story that changes with every playthrough.

Mastering ATB Deckbuilding: Core Gameplay Mechanics

You explore a grid map in turn-based gameplay, moving through events, shops, and battles while building a deck from over 300 different cards. Choose from nine different Braves, each with its own skill trees and card pools. Then, recruit an ally from the tavern to make combos that work well with your strategies, like aggressive rushes or defensive counters.

In ATB style, combat starts with cards charging in real time, which means you have to make split-second choices. Turn on bullet-time to slow down the action and time your attacks, blocks, dodges, or MAX moves perfectly. This hybrid system takes deckbuilding to the next level by rewarding players who learn enemy patterns and deck synergy instead of just luck. There are seven stages with different enemies and loot to help you improve your builds.
